URL Kodlayıcı
Birim Dönüştürücü
- {{ unit.name }}
- {{ unit.name }} ({{updateToValue(fromUnit, unit, fromValue)}})
Alıntı
Aşağıdaki alıntıyı kullanarak bunu bibliyografinize ekleyin:
Find More Calculator ☟
URL kodlama, web geliştirmede ve internet üzerinden veri iletiminde önemlidir. Özellikle özel karakterler, boşluklar veya isteğin bütünlüğünü bozabilecek semboller içeren URL'lerin web tarayıcıları ve sunucular tarafından doğru yorumlanmasını sağlar.
Tarihsel Arka Plan
URL kodlama, yüzde kodlaması olarak da bilinir, belirli durumlarda bir Tekdüzen Kaynak Tanımlayıcısı'ndaki (URI) bilgileri kodlama mekanizmasıdır. URL'ler genellikle ASCII kümesi dışındaki sınırlı bir karakter kümesine izin verdiğinden, bu kodlama güvenli olmayan ASCII karakterlerini, karakterin ASCII kodunu temsil eden iki onaltılık basamağın ardından bir "%" ile değiştirir.
Hesaplama Formülü
URL kodlama, güvenli olmayan karakterleri "%" ve ardından iki onaltılık basamakla değiştirir. Örneğin, bir boşluk karakteri (" ") "%20" ile değiştirilir.
Örnek Hesaplama
https://example.com/about us URL'sini kodlamak için, kodlanmış URL şu şekilde olur:
https://example.com/about%20us
Önemi ve Kullanım Senaryoları
URL kodlama, web formlarında veri göndermek için verileri hazırlamada ve verilerin değiştirilmeden iletilmesini sağlamada kullanılır. Özellikle sorgu dizilerini ve bir URL'nin yol bölümünü kodlamak için önemlidir.
Sıkça Sorulan Sorular
-
Neden URL'leri kodlamamız gerekiyor?
- Kodlama, URL'nin web sunucuları ve tarayıcılar tarafından doğru yorumlanmasını sağlar, özellikle de URL kontrol karakterleri ile karıştırılabilecek özel karakterler içeren URL'ler için.
-
Bir URL'de hangi karakterlerin kodlanması gerekir?
- Genellikle, alfasayısal olmayan veya "-_.~" karakterlerinden biri olmayan karakterlerin kodlanması gerekir. Buna boşluklar, noktalama işaretleri ve özel semboller dâhildir.
-
Kodlama, bir URL'nin anlamını değiştirebilir mi?
- Hayır, kodlama, özel karakterlerin URL'nin yapısına müdahale etmesini engelleyerek URL'nin orijinal anlamını korur.
URL Kodlayıcı aracı, URL'leri kodlamak için basit bir yol sunarak web geliştirme görevlerini daha yönetilebilir hale getirir ve iletim sırasında veri bütünlüğünü sağlar.